如何获取这个div当前的位置

如何获取这个div当前的位置,第1张

divObjclientWidth>=documentbodyclientWidth //判断最有两边是否有超出body体(可以换成你自己的层)

divObjclientHeight>=documentbodyclientHeight //判断上下两边是否有超出body体(可以换成你自己的层)

divObj是你里面呢个被移动的div

css3的一些新增的属性 例如translate结果是不会更改盒子模型的,也就是说 比如scale放大缩小后,盒子大小仍然是变化之前,你可以先取一下盒子本身的位置,然后怎么translate,怎么再计算一下,就可以啦

第一、先要把这个div的定位设为 relative 或者 absolute,比如:

<div id="d1" style="margin-top: 3;margin-left: -5;width: 470;height: 25;position:relative" ></div>

第二、离浏览器头部的位置top值: documentgetElementById('d1')offsetTop+documentbodyscrollTop

left值:documentgetElementById('d1')offsetLeft;

以上就是关于如何获取这个div当前的位置全部的内容,包括:如何获取这个div当前的位置、css3 tansition动画完成后,div的位置怎么确定、js获取某个div离浏览器头部的位置等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/web/9656671.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-30
下一篇2023-04-30

发表评论

登录后才能评论

评论列表(0条)

    保存